One of the best logging programs I have ever
found was recently recommended to me by a DXer in
Colorado, it includes things like online packet
notifications, log (of course) and even
'chatting' with other DXers online IN the
program.
It's called XMlog, at where else, xmlog.com. It
has a bunch of features and you can even, if you
find a better program at a later date, download
in into that format. Luckily I was able to
operate this in reverse and download my combined
logs from WINLOG and LogEQF, into it, so I did
not lose 20 years+ of DXing info.
